Understanding Sweetener Categories for Diabetics
Navigating the vast array of sweeteners can feel a bit like decoding a secret language, especially when you’re focused on managing blood sugar. To make informed decisions, it’s helpful to understand the basic categories of sweeteners and how each impacts your body. Let’s break them down so you can easily spot what’s what on an ingredient label.
* Nutritive Sweeteners: These are the traditional sugars we often think of, and they do exactly what their name implies – they provide nutrition in the form of calories and carbohydrates. This means they will directly affect your blood sugar levels. Examples include common table sugar (sucrose), the fructose found in fruit, glucose, honey, maple syrup, brown sugar, and agave nectar. For individuals with diabetes, these are generally limited or avoided entirely because of their significant impact on blood glucose. While they offer sweetness and energy, they can make blood sugar management challenging and contribute to unwanted spikes.
* Non-Nutritive Sweeteners (NNS): Often referred to as “sugar substitutes” or “artificial sweeteners,” these powerhouses offer intense sweetness with virtually no calories or carbohydrates. Because they provide negligible energy and aren’t metabolized in a way that raises blood glucose, they have minimal to no impact on blood sugar levels. This makes them a fantastic option for diabetics looking to enjoy sweet tastes without the blood sugar rollercoaster. They are incredibly potent, meaning only tiny amounts are needed to achieve desired sweetness, making them a popular choice in diet drinks, sugar-free products, and for personal use.
* Sugar Alcohols: Don’t let the “alcohol” in their name fool you – these aren’t intoxicating! Sugar alcohols are carbohydrates found naturally in some fruits and vegetables, and they are also manufactured. They offer sweetness, but with fewer calories and carbohydrates than regular sugar. While they do contain calories (typically about half that of sugar) and can slightly affect blood sugar, their impact is much less significant than nutritive sweeteners. Common examples include xylitol, sorbitol, and maltitol. However, a word of caution: consuming them in larger amounts can sometimes lead to digestive issues like bloating, gas, and even diarrhea because they are not fully absorbed by the body.
Top Non-Nutritive Sweeteners (NNS) Explained
When it comes to enjoying a sweet taste without the worry of blood sugar spikes, non-nutritive sweeteners are often the stars of the show for those managing diabetes. Among these, a few natural options truly stand out for their excellent profiles.
* Stevia: Imagine a sweetener derived from a humble plant, offering intense sweetness without a single calorie or carbohydrate – that’s stevia! Originating from the leaves of the *Stevia rebaudiana* plant, native to South America, stevia has been used for centuries. Its sweet compounds, called steviol glycosides, are many times sweeter than sugar. Stevia has a clean, natural taste for many, though some individuals might detect a slight licorice-like aftertaste. It’s incredibly versatile and available in various forms: liquid drops perfect for beverages, powdered extracts for baking, and granulated blends that often contain a bulking agent like erythritol to make it measure more like sugar. It has virtually no impact on blood sugar, making it a beloved choice for diabetic-friendly recipes and everyday use.
* Monk Fruit Extract: Hailing from Southeast Asia, monk fruit (or *Siraitia grosvenorii*) is a small, green melon whose extract is another fantastic natural, zero-calorie sweetener. The sweetness comes from compounds called mogrosides, which are powerful antioxidants and give monk fruit its intense sweet flavor without affecting glucose levels. Many people find monk fruit to have a very clean, neutral taste profile, even less likely to have an aftertaste than stevia, which makes it a popular choice for those sensitive to other sweeteners. Like stevia, it’s available in various forms and is a superb option for adding sweetness to drinks, desserts, and cooking without worrying about carbohydrates or calories.
* Erythritol: While technically a sugar alcohol, erythritol is unique enough to often be grouped with non-nutritive sweeteners due to its minimal impact. What makes it special? It’s almost calorie-free (about 0.24 calories per gram compared to sugar’s 4 calories per gram) and, crucially, it’s generally very well-tolerated digestively. This is because most of the erythritol you consume is absorbed into the bloodstream before being excreted unchanged in the urine, rather than fermenting in the colon like other sugar alcohols. This means fewer chances of bloating or gas! Erythritol has about 70% of the sweetness of sugar and offers a clean, mild taste with a slight cooling sensation. It’s fantastic for baking because it caramelizes nicely and provides bulk, mimicking sugar’s texture in recipes without the glycemic load.
Artificial Sweeteners: What to Know
Artificial sweeteners, a subset of non-nutritive sweeteners, have been around for a while and are widely used. They offer powerful sweetness without the calories, making them attractive for managing weight and blood sugar. However, they also come with a fair bit of discussion and debate.
* Common Types: When we talk about artificial sweeteners, a few names usually come to mind. Aspartame is one of the oldest and most studied, found in many “diet” sodas and sugar-free products. Sucralose, widely known by its brand name Splenda, is derived from sugar through a chemical process that makes it calorie-free. Saccharin, an even older sweetener, is sometimes found in “sugar-free” soft drinks and tabletop packets. These are all intensely sweet synthetic compounds with virtually no calories, offering a way to enjoy sweetness without the glycemic impact.
* Safety and Research: The safety of artificial sweeteners has been a hot topic for decades. Regulatory bodies around the world, such as the U.S. Food and Drug Administration (FDA) and the European Food Safety Authority (EFSA), have approved these sweeteners for consumption after extensive research. They are considered safe for the general population within acceptable daily intake (ADI) levels. However, ongoing scientific debate and new research continue to explore potential long-term effects on gut microbiome, metabolism, and appetite. It’s a complex area, and while regulatory bodies stand by their safety, individual sensitivities and evolving science mean it’s worth staying informed.
* Moderation is Key: Given the ongoing discussions and the fact that everyone’s body is unique, moderation is truly key with artificial sweeteners. While generally safe within approved limits, some individuals may choose to limit their consumption or pay close attention to how their body responds. For example, some people report digestive discomfort or headaches from certain artificial sweeteners. Listening to your body and consulting with your healthcare provider can help you determine what works best for you and your personal health goals.
Sugar Alcohols: Use with Caution
Sugar alcohols can be a helpful tool for reducing sugar intake, but they require a bit more attention and caution, especially for those with diabetes. They offer fewer calories and a lower glycemic impact than regular sugar, but they’re not entirely calorie-free or without potential side effects.
* Examples: You’ll frequently encounter sugar alcohols in various “sugar-free” or “no sugar added” products. Xylitol is very popular, known for its dental benefits (it can help reduce cavity-causing bacteria) and often found in sugar-free gum, mints, and some toothpastes. Just be aware that xylitol is highly toxic to dogs, so keep it away from pets! Sorbitol is another common one, used in sugar-free candies, cough syrups, and chewing gum. Maltitol is particularly sweet and is frequently found in “sugar-free” chocolates and baked goods, as it mimics sugar’s texture and taste very well. Other examples include mannitol and lactitol.
* Potential Glycemic Impact: While all sugar alcohols generally have a lower glycemic index than regular sugar, their impact isn’t zero, and it varies. Maltitol, for instance, has a higher glycemic index compared to erythritol or xylitol, meaning it can still slightly raise blood sugar levels, sometimes more significantly than other sugar alcohols. This is crucial for diabetics to remember: “sugar-free” doesn’t always mean “carb-free” or “blood sugar-impact-free.” Always check the nutrition label for total carbohydrates and factor in sugar alcohol content, especially if you’re sensitive.
* Digestive Side Effects: This is perhaps the most common caveat with sugar alcohols. Because they are only partially absorbed in the small intestine, the unabsorbed portion travels to the large intestine, where gut bacteria can ferment them. This fermentation process can lead to uncomfortable digestive side effects, including bloating, gas, and diarrhea, especially when consumed in larger quantities. Individuals vary widely in their tolerance, so it’s wise to start with small amounts and observe your body’s reaction. If you find yourself reaching for several “sugar-free” cookies, be mindful that the cumulative effect of the sugar alcohols could lead to an upset stomach.
Natural Sweeteners to Limit or Avoid
The word “natural” often carries a healthy halo, leading many to believe that natural sweeteners are automatically a better choice, especially for managing diabetes. However, when it comes to blood sugar management, “natural” doesn’t necessarily equate to “diabetic-friendly.” In fact, many popular natural sweeteners are essentially just sugar in a different form and should be limited or avoided.
* Honey, Maple Syrup, Agave Nectar: These are often lauded for being “natural” and containing beneficial nutrients or antioxidants. While they do offer some micronutrients, their primary component is sugar. Honey is a mix of fructose and glucose, maple syrup is mostly sucrose, and agave nectar is notably high in fructose. All of these significantly impact blood glucose levels, much like table sugar does, and sometimes even more so due to their concentrated sugar content. For individuals with diabetes, regularly consuming these can lead to blood sugar spikes and make glycemic control challenging, making them unsuitable for consistent use.
* Coconut Sugar & Date Sugar: These sweeteners have gained popularity as “healthier” alternatives to white sugar. Coconut sugar is derived from the sap of coconut palm trees, and date sugar is made from dried, ground dates. While they might retain slightly more nutrients than highly refined white sugar and have a slightly lower glycemic index than table sugar, they still contain significant amounts of sugar (mostly sucrose) and calories. They offer no major advantage over table sugar for managing diabetes effectively and will still raise blood glucose levels considerably. Don’t be fooled by their exotic names; chemically and calorically, they behave very similarly to other nutritive sugars.
* Focus on Alternatives: The key takeaway here is to emphasize that for effective diabetes management, prioritizing taste and health means looking beyond the “natural” label. While a tiny amount of these sweeteners might be okay on rare occasions for some, the everyday focus should be on non-nutritive options like stevia, monk fruit, and erythritol. These provide the desired sweetness without the unwanted blood sugar impact, truly supporting your health goals.
Making Your Best Choice: Key Considerations
Choosing the best sweetener when you have diabetes isn’t just about picking one from a list; it’s a personalized journey that involves understanding your body, reading labels, and making informed decisions. Here are some key considerations to guide you toward your best choices.
* Individual Blood Sugar Response: This is arguably the most critical factor. What works well for one person with diabetes might have a different effect on another. The best way to understand your personal response is to monitor your glucose levels diligently. When you introduce a new sweetener or a product containing one, check your blood sugar before consumption and again about one to two hours afterward. Keep a log. This practice will reveal how different options truly affect *your* body, empowering you to make choices based on real data, not just general recommendations.
* Taste and Preference: Let’s be honest: if you don’t enjoy the taste of a sweetener, you won’t stick with it. The “best” sweetener is often one that you find palatable and that satisfies your craving for sweetness without any unpleasant aftertastes. Experiment with different non-nutritive sweeteners like stevia, monk fruit, and erythritol, and even blends of these. You might find that you prefer one for your coffee and another for baking. Finding a sweetener you genuinely like is crucial for long-term adherence to your dietary goals without feeling deprived.
* Check Ingredient Labels: This can’t be stressed enough! Food manufacturers are clever, and “sugar-free” doesn’t always mean what you think. Many products use combination sweeteners to achieve a balanced taste, or they might hide sugars under different names. Always read the full ingredient list to identify all sweeteners present, especially if you’re trying to pinpoint what might be causing a particular blood sugar response or digestive issue. Also, look for hidden nutritive sugars that might appear elsewhere in the ingredient list, even in “diet” or “sugar-free” items.

Frequently Asked Questions
What is the best overall sweetener option for people with diabetes?
There isn’t a single “best” sweetener for all people with diabetes, as individual responses and preferences vary. However, non-nutritive sweeteners like stevia, monk fruit extract, and erythritol are often recommended due to their minimal impact on blood glucose levels. These sugar substitutes offer sweetness without the added calories or carbohydrates that can affect blood sugar management, making them excellent choices for controlling diabetes. Always prioritize options that are zero-calorie or very low in carbohydrates to help maintain healthy blood sugar.
Which types of artificial sweeteners are generally considered safe for diabetics, and how do they work?
Artificial sweeteners such as sucralose (Splenda), aspartame (NutraSweet, Equal), acesulfame potassium (Ace-K), and saccharin are generally considered safe for diabetics when consumed in moderation and within acceptable daily intake levels. These sweeteners are many times sweeter than sugar but are not metabolized for energy, meaning they do not raise blood sugar levels or contribute calories. They provide a sweet taste without affecting glucose control, making them a useful sugar alternative for managing diabetes effectively.
Why are natural zero-calorie sweeteners like Stevia and Monk Fruit popular choices for diabetics?
Natural zero-calorie sweeteners like Stevia and Monk Fruit are popular among diabetics because they are derived from plants and provide intense sweetness without increasing blood glucose levels. These extracts contain compounds (steviol glycosides in stevia, mogrosides in monk fruit) that are intensely sweet but pass through the body largely undigested, offering a sugar-free alternative. Their natural origin and lack of impact on blood sugar make them excellent choices for maintaining diabetic health and satisfying sweet cravings responsibly.
How can diabetics choose the right sugar substitute for their individual needs and dietary goals?
Choosing the right sugar substitute involves considering personal taste preferences, potential digestive sensitivities, and consulting with a healthcare professional or registered dietitian. Diabetics should read food labels carefully to identify hidden sugars or carbohydrates, even in “sugar-free” products. It’s also wise to experiment with different types—like erythritol for baking or liquid stevia for drinks—and monitor how your body, particularly your blood sugar, responds to each sweetener. This personalized approach ensures effective blood sugar management while enjoying sweet foods.
Are there any specific sweeteners or sugar alternatives that diabetics should be cautious about or avoid entirely?
Diabetics should definitely avoid regular table sugar, high-fructose corn syrup, and other caloric sugars that significantly raise blood glucose levels. While sugar alcohols like xylitol, sorbitol, and maltitol are sugar-free, they can still have a minor impact on blood sugar and may cause digestive discomfort (like bloating or diarrhea) if consumed in large quantities. It’s crucial to be cautious with these and always check the “net carbs” on labels, especially if you have sensitive digestion or strict carbohydrate limits for diabetes management.
